If you love the tradition of naming baby after a significant person in your life, maybe you should consider Harrisson. Originally a surname, Harrisson is typically a masculine moniker. It derives from Middle English and means “son of Harry.” Harry is a variation of Henry, which stems from Heimirich, signifying “home ruler” in Old German. Also spelled Harrison, this name has made a splash in Hollywood. Legend Harrison Ford famously starred as the titular character in the Indiana Jones film series, amongst other credits.
